Auckland Sprintcar Club (Official) On behalf of the Sprintcar Drivers who raced the Grand Prix under very challenging conditions last night at Western Springs Speedway, the club wish to apologise to every single fan that came out last night to watch and support your favourite drivers. We know your there and wish we could provide the top level entertainment you have paid for but we can only race on the conditions that are provided and despite many attempts to work with the providers we have been unsuccessful to help rectify the problems.
This season has been a challenge to say the least and with one night left at The Springs we can only hope our sprintcar fans, supporters, sponsors etc are still there at the end with us. The show must go on and the drivers are doing everything they can to provide you all with the level of entertainment you have come to enjoy in past years.

After last nights meeting I walked the track following Graeme Standring, he was stopping to pick up large u shaped pins from the surface. Graeme was telling me that these were used to hold covers on the track for the Eminem concert. He had picked up 20 during the meeting. My question is, if the track was prepared "properly" harrowed, watered and turned again why would these pins be on the surface still knocked into the track where they were placed weeks ago ?? How has this happened ?? Greg Mosen stood up at a meeting and told us they knew what they were doing wrong and had a plan in place to fix it. They had met with other track prep teams and understood what needed to be done. GREG IT HASNT HAPPENED !!!! Greg you told us the large water truck would no longer be used as it was creating large ruts. FAIL AGAIN !!!!! nuts Greg, its not looking good here.
